LOVE LETTER II

About a mile past McKinley Pond
Lived a girl of whom I was very fond
Golden tresses framed her face
Seeing her made my heart race

Eyes like copper, sparkling bright
Watching her was quite a sight
Strolling the meadow every day
Picking up pawpaws along the way

I wanted to tell her what was on my heart
But I didn't know just where to start
I decided I'd mail her a little note
And these are the words I finally wrote

You are the girl of my fondest dreams
My thoughts flow like mountain streams
I watch you as you stroll carefree
But don't think you ever noticed me

I see you from my hiding place
And marvel at your gorgeous face
At night my dreams are all of you
I wake up wondering what to do

To let you know I hope to find
The words to ask you to be mine
Now you know just how I feel
So I pray you tell me that you will

She wrote back and said to me
I'll be yours and you will see
That all your dreams will soon be true
Because I feel the same way too
